During the Sunday, July 6, episode of “Love Island USA,” narrator Iain Stirling announced that Cierra Ortega had left the show due to a “personal situation.” Prior to her shocking exit, many fans called for Ortega’s removal after discovering that she used a slur for Chinese people in several social media posts.
Contestants Yulissa Escobar and Cierra Ortega were removed from 'Love Island USA' for past use of racial slurs.
